Centre organises business summit for NE state

Aizawl, April 2: Union Ministry of Commerce and Ministry of Development of Northeast Region(DoNER) will be jointly organising a business summit in New Delhi in the second week of April to attract investors to this region.

Official sources here today said that the two-day summit is scheduled to begin on April 10 and all the northeastern states, including Sikkim, will join the summit to showcase their natural resources, potential and possibilities of industrialisation.

Sources said the organisers have asked the NE states to focus on development of tourism as well as to highlight the possibilities of rubber-based industry and explore the potential of tea, handloom and handicrafts industry.

Earlier, both NEC and DoNER had made a blue-print to attract external investment to NE states with technical assistance from Asian Development Bank, sources said, adding that it sought to develop a trade and investment framework in the region.

Sources further stated that if the project was implemented, NE region would be able to occupy a better position in the global and regional markets and reap considerable gains from specialisation, agglomeration of economies and globalisation.
